3.10 Chanhua Beaded Edge Leaf

1. Prepare one piece of 0.4mm copper wire, two pieces of 0.3mm copper wire, a leaf template, silk threads, and some 2mm beads. To make it easier, let's call the two 0.3mm wires Wire A and Wire B.

2. Hold all three wires together. Follow the first five steps of the single leaf technique to wrap a short section.

3. After wrapping, pull out Wire A. Then continue wrapping with thread for about 4mm.

4. Hold the thread tightly without letting go. Add one bead onto Wire A. Then bend Wire A back to the back side of the template, so the bead sits at the edge of the leaf.

5. Place Wire A on the back of the template. Then pull out Wire B. Wrap normally for about 4mm.

6. Thread one bead onto Wire B. Then pull Wire B to the back of the template. At the same time, pull out Wire A again.

7. Repeat the previous steps, alternating between adding beads on Wire A and Wire B as you wrap. This creates a beaded edge effect.

8. Wrap until you reach the right spot. Then finish wrapping the rest of the leaf completely as usual.

9. Your beaded edge leaf is now complete.
